What is a Vacuum Robot?A vacuum robot, also described as a robotic vacuum cleaner, is an autonomous gadget developed to perform the task of cleaning floorings without the requirement for human intervention. Geared up with sensing automatic vacuum cleaner and navigation systems, these gadgets can move around the home, find dirt and particles, and successfully clean surface areas like hardwood, tile, and carpet.
Features of Vacuum Robots
Vacuum robots include a range of functions that enhance their functionality and usability. A few of the typical functions consist of:
- Smart Navigation Technology: Many vacuum robotics are equipped with innovative sensing units and mapping innovation, enabling them to create a map of the home for effective cleaning paths.
- HEPA Filters: High-Efficiency Particulate Air (HEPA) filters trap fine dust and irritants, making vacuum robots a suitable choice for allergic reaction victims.
- Wi-Fi Connectivity: Some designs enable users to manage the robot through a mobile phone app or voice commands using smart home systems like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ant.
- Scheduled Cleaning: Users can set cleaning schedules, permitting the robot to run automatically at specified times.
- Dirt Sensors: These sensing units identify areas with heavy dirt and gunk, triggering the robot to focus more cleaning power on those areas.
The appeal of vacuum robotics can be credited to numerous benefits they use over standard cleaning techniques. A few of these benefits consist of:
- Time-Saving: A vacuum robot can clean up while its owner carries out other jobs, permitting multitasking and effective usage of time.
- Convenience: With scheduling and push-button control functions, property owners can set the robot to clean their homes even when they are not present.
- Consistency: Regular cleaning schedules ensure that the home remains clean, lowering the accumulation of dust and debris.
- Availability: Vacuum robotics can quickly browse under furniture and reach tight areas, making sure a thorough tidy in locations that are frequently overlooked with conventional vacuum.
- User-Friendly: Most designs are developed for easy operation, frequently needing very little setup and upkeep.

Performance on Different Surfaces
Vacuum robots vary in effectiveness depending upon the types of surfaces they clean. Owners must think about:
- Hardwood Floors: Most models perform effectively on wood however might differ in efficiency with particles like animal hair.
- Carpets: Look for robotics geared up with brush rollers for much better performance on carpets, particularly those with a high pile.
- Combined Surfaces: For homes with a mix of floor types, choose models created for flexible cleaning.
Battery Life and Charging
Battery life plays a vital function in the performance of a vacuum robot. Consider:
- Run Time: Look for designs that provide a longer runtime, preferably around 90 to 120 minutes, to ensure appropriate protection of your home.
- Self-Charging Capability: Many vacuum robots go back to their charging docks when their battery runs low, which adds benefit.

How does a vacuum robot browse around the home?Vacuum robots normally utilize numerous sensing units (e.g., infrared or laser) to identify obstacles and spiral patterns to cover hard-to-reach locations. Advanced models use mapping innovation to intelligently prepare their routes.
Can vacuum robots clean stairs?No, vacuum robotics are not created to tidy stairs successfully, as they are flat and need manual intervention for stair cleaning.
How often should I run my vacuum robot?It is typically suggested to run vacuum robotics day-to-day or every other day, specifically in homes with family pets or heavy foot traffic.
Do vacuum robotics work well with pet hair?Many modern vacuum robotics are designed specifically with pet owners in mind, including strong suction and specialized brushes to deal with animal hair successfully.
Can I utilize my vacuum robot on rugs?The majority of vacuum robotics can clean up low to medium stack rugs, but it's best to check the specifications of the design for compatibility with specific kinds of carpets.
